FAQs About Austin Tx Elevation Map
Q: What is the highest point in Austin?
A: The highest point in Austin is Mount Bonnell, which has an elevation of 775 feet.
Q: Are there any hiking trails in Austin?
A: Yes! One popular hiking trail is the Barton Creek Greenbelt, which offers over 12 miles of scenic trails.
Q: What is the best time of year to visit Austin?
A: The best time to visit Austin is during the spring or fall, when the weather is mild and comfortable.
Q: Are there any indoor attractions in Austin?
A: Yes! Some popular indoor attractions include the LBJ Presidential Library, the Texas State History Museum, and the Austin City Limits Live at the Moody Theater.
